Google Classroom can be easy to start with, but a school may eventually need a broader academic system. Before replacing it, separate the simple classroom workflow from the services that need stronger institutional ownership.
Inventory the content that must move: classes, students, assignments, submissions, feedback, and shared files. Confirm which items can be exported, which need manual review, and which should be archived instead of copied.
The replacement should also be tested from the student, teacher, and administration perspectives. A new interface is not enough if the school still needs separate tools for grades, attendance, calendars, and family communication.

What a good LMS should really cover
- A documented inventory and migration plan
- Class, assignment, submission, and feedback continuity
- A clear grade and attendance workflow
- Permissions that fit students, teachers, and administrators
- A pilot with real users before the final switch
